数据仓库概念模型(数据仓库概念模型的五个组成部分)

数据仓库概念模型

简介

数据仓库概念模型概述了数据仓库中数据的逻辑结构和组织方式。它提供了一个抽象视图,以了解数据仓库中信息的组织方式、数据流以及数据之间的关系。

多级标题

1. 星型模式

最常见的数据仓库模型

中心表包含事务数据

维度表包含描述数据的数据

2. 雪花模式

星型模式的扩展,具有规范化的维度表

减少冗余,提高查询性能

3. 事实星座

多个事实表链接到共享的维度表

允许对不同主题领域进行多维分析

4. 数据立方

多维数据的逻辑模型

允许根据不同的维度进行汇总和分析

内容详细说明

星型模式

星型模式是一个中心的事实表,周围环绕着多个维度表。事实表存储事务数据,而维度表存储描述事务的信息(例如日期、客户、产品)。星型模式易于理解、查询和维护。

雪花模式

雪花模式是一种扩展的星型模式,其中维度表被进一步规范化。这减少了冗余并提高了查询性能。然而,它也使得模型更加复杂,维护起来更具挑战性。

事实星座

事实星座是一种数据仓库模型,其中多个事实表链接到共享的维度表。这允许跨不同主题领域进行多维分析。事实星座比星型或雪花模式更灵活,但它们也更难设计和维护。

数据立方

数据立方是一种多维数据的逻辑模型。它允许根据不同的维度对数据进行汇总和分析。数据立方通常用于联机分析处理(OLAP)应用程序。

优势

提供数据仓库逻辑结构的清晰视图

提高数据仓库设计和维护效率

促进数据仓库和业务需求之间的对齐

优化查询性能和数据访问

局限性

可能无法表示所有数据关系

随着数据仓库复杂性的增加,维护起来可能具有挑战性

可能不适用于所有数据仓库应用程序

**数据仓库概念模型****简介**数据仓库概念模型概述了数据仓库中数据的逻辑结构和组织方式。它提供了一个抽象视图,以了解数据仓库中信息的组织方式、数据流以及数据之间的关系。**多级标题****1. 星型模式*** 最常见的数据仓库模型 * 中心表包含事务数据 * 维度表包含描述数据的数据**2. 雪花模式*** 星型模式的扩展,具有规范化的维度表 * 减少冗余,提高查询性能**3. 事实星座*** 多个事实表链接到共享的维度表 * 允许对不同主题领域进行多维分析**4. 数据立方*** 多维数据的逻辑模型 * 允许根据不同的维度进行汇总和分析**内容详细说明****星型模式**星型模式是一个中心的事实表,周围环绕着多个维度表。事实表存储事务数据,而维度表存储描述事务的信息(例如日期、客户、产品)。星型模式易于理解、查询和维护。**雪花模式**雪花模式是一种扩展的星型模式,其中维度表被进一步规范化。这减少了冗余并提高了查询性能。然而,它也使得模型更加复杂,维护起来更具挑战性。**事实星座**事实星座是一种数据仓库模型,其中多个事实表链接到共享的维度表。这允许跨不同主题领域进行多维分析。事实星座比星型或雪花模式更灵活,但它们也更难设计和维护。**数据立方**数据立方是一种多维数据的逻辑模型。它允许根据不同的维度对数据进行汇总和分析。数据立方通常用于联机分析处理(OLAP)应用程序。**优势*** 提供数据仓库逻辑结构的清晰视图 * 提高数据仓库设计和维护效率 * 促进数据仓库和业务需求之间的对齐 * 优化查询性能和数据访问**局限性*** 可能无法表示所有数据关系 * 随着数据仓库复杂性的增加,维护起来可能具有挑战性 * 可能不适用于所有数据仓库应用程序

标签列表